## Step 4: Point the reset tool at the new auth store

Heads up, support folks — the old Keylane reset dashboard is retired. The revamped flow in Passwhirl now writes tokens straight to the auth database, so expired-link complaints should drop way off. When you run the bulk reset script for a customer, it needs the new database target. Paste the following connection string into the config prompt when asked.

primary connection of yagep-kahip = redis://giliel_svc:zYiKsLL2PLpfPL@db-348f.xolmarsys.corp:5432/fenwyn

## Step 7: Verify SDK parity

Before approving the cut-over from the Strandel legacy SDK to the new Korvex client, confirm both expose identical auth scopes and request-signing behavior. Any endpoint present in one SDK but not the other must be flagged. Parity checks run against the staging gateway using the client configuration values listed below.

config for tagep-yajef:
ulawyn:
  log_level: error
  metrics_host: metrics.ulawyn.lumiclabs.internal
  pin: 0564
  pool_size: 32

Ticket #913 — relevance notes stuck in locked vault. Hey, quick one before you review my ranking PR: all my search relevance tuning notes (synonym weights, the boost curve for Larkspur listings) are in the team vault, which locked itself after the rotation botch on Monday. You'll want those notes for context. Unlock it with the recovery passphrase below.

recovery phrase for fajep-yaweg: gilath-sorox-wenius-rusdor-keliel-zorius